flash loan

Flash Loan is an uncollateralized DeFi lending mechanism that allows users to borrow funds and repay them within a single block transaction. Characterized by atomicity—where the entire borrowing process either completely succeeds or fails and reverts—these loans enable sophisticated operations like arbitrage, debt refinancing, and liquidations without requiring traditional collateral.
flash loan

Flash Loan is an uncollateralized DeFi (Decentralized Finance) lending product that allows users to borrow large amounts of funds and repay them within a single block transaction. This innovative lending mechanism originated in the Ethereum ecosystem and was first introduced by the Aave protocol in 2020. What makes flash loans unique is their atomicity—the transaction either executes completely (borrowing, usage, and repayment all succeed) or fails entirely and reverts. This has made flash loans an important tool for advanced DeFi strategies like arbitrage, debt refinancing, and liquidations, while also triggering a series of security incidents and concerns about DeFi ecosystem stability.

Work Mechanism: How does Flash Loan work?

The working mechanism of flash loans is based on the atomicity of blockchain transactions and involves the following process:

  1. Borrowing phase: Users borrow funds from a liquidity pool through a smart contract without providing collateral.
  2. Execution phase: The borrower uses the borrowed funds to execute predefined operations (like arbitrage, liquidations, etc.).
  3. Repayment phase: Within the same block transaction, the borrower returns the principal plus a fee.
  4. Verification phase: If repayment is successful, the transaction is confirmed; if repayment fails, the entire transaction is rolled back, returning funds to the original liquidity pool.

Flash loans rely on the smart contract call/delegate call mechanism, allowing borrowers to execute custom logic before repayment. This design eliminates the credit risk of traditional loans because if borrowers cannot repay, the entire transaction is automatically canceled as if it never happened.

What are the main features of Flash Loan?

  1. No collateral requirement: Flash loans don't require borrowers to provide any collateral, breaking a core requirement of traditional lending.

  2. Technical complexity:

  • Requires borrowers to have smart contract development skills or use specialized tools
  • Necessitates precise calculation of gas fees and transaction execution paths
  • Typically involves interaction with multiple DeFi protocols
  1. Use Cases and Advantages:
  • Arbitrage: Profiting from price differences between different exchanges or protocols
  • Liquidations: Efficiently executing liquidations on under-collateralized positions
  • Debt refinancing: Repaying and rebuilding debt positions in a single transaction to optimize interest rates or collateralization ratios
  • Liquidity oracle manipulation: Rapidly acquiring large amounts of funds to influence price oracles
  1. Security Concerns:
  • Used in multiple DeFi protocol attacks worth millions of dollars
  • Can be used to manipulate oracle prices and market prices
  • Protocol vulnerabilities can be exploited at scale via flash loans

Future Outlook: What's next for Flash Loan?

Flash loan technology is evolving in several directions:

  1. Cross-chain flash loans: Researchers are developing solutions to allow flash loans across different blockchains, which would significantly expand their application scope and arbitrage opportunities.

  2. Security enhancements: Protocol developers are implementing more sophisticated oracle systems and price delay mechanisms to mitigate flash loan attack risks.

  3. User-friendly tools: Multiple projects are building no-code interfaces that enable average users to leverage flash loans for complex DeFi operations, reducing the technical barrier to entry.

  4. Regulatory attention: As DeFi regulatory frameworks take shape, flash loans may face increased regulatory scrutiny, particularly regarding market manipulation and financial stability concerns.

  5. Innovative applications: Flash loans are being integrated into automated trading strategies, risk management tools, and more sophisticated financial products, driving further innovation in the DeFi ecosystem.

Flash loans represent a disruptive technology in the DeFi space, exemplifying how smart contracts and blockchain can fundamentally reimagine financial services. This technology eliminates traditional time constraints and credit risks in lending, creating an entirely new paradigm for financial transactions. While flash loans offer unprecedented capital efficiency and trading opportunities, they also introduce systemic risks and new attack vectors. As the DeFi ecosystem matures, the evolution of flash loan technology will continue to challenge our traditional understanding of lending, liquidity, and financial security. Whether as an innovative tool or a potential threat, flash loans have undoubtedly become a key component of modern decentralized finance.

A simple like goes a long way

Share

Related Glossaries
apr
Annual Percentage Rate (APR) is a financial metric expressing the percentage of interest earned or charged over a one-year period without accounting for compounding effects. In cryptocurrency, APR measures the annualized yield or cost of lending platforms, staking services, and liquidity pools, serving as a standardized indicator for investors to compare earnings potential across different DeFi protocols.
apy
Annual Percentage Yield (APY) is a financial metric that calculates investment returns while accounting for the compounding effect, representing the total percentage return capital might generate over a one-year period. In cryptocurrency, APY is widely used in DeFi activities such as staking, lending, and liquidity mining to measure and compare potential returns across different investment options.
LTV
Loan-to-Value ratio (LTV) is a key metric in DeFi lending platforms that measures the proportion between borrowed value and collateral value. It represents the maximum percentage of value a user can borrow against their collateral assets, serving to manage system risk and prevent liquidations due to asset price volatility. Different crypto assets are assigned varying maximum LTV ratios based on their volatility and liquidity characteristics, establishing a secure and sustainable lending ecosystem.
Rug Pull
A Rug Pull is a cryptocurrency scam where project developers suddenly withdraw liquidity or abandon the project after collecting investor funds, causing token value to crash to near-zero. This type of fraud typically occurs on decentralized exchanges (DEXs), especially those using automated market maker (AMM) protocols, with perpetrators disappearing after successfully extracting funds.
amm
Automated Market Maker (AMM) is a decentralized trading protocol that uses mathematical algorithms and liquidity pools instead of traditional order books to automate cryptocurrency transactions. AMMs employ constant functions (typically the constant product formula x*y=k) to determine asset prices, allowing users to trade without counterparties, serving as core infrastructure for the decentralized finance (DeFi) ecosystem.

Related Articles

In-depth Explanation of Yala: Building a Modular DeFi Yield Aggregator with $YU Stablecoin as a Medium
Beginner

In-depth Explanation of Yala: Building a Modular DeFi Yield Aggregator with $YU Stablecoin as a Medium

Yala inherits the security and decentralization of Bitcoin while using a modular protocol framework with the $YU stablecoin as a medium of exchange and store of value. It seamlessly connects Bitcoin with major ecosystems, allowing Bitcoin holders to earn yield from various DeFi protocols.
11-29-2024, 10:10:11 AM
Sui: How are users leveraging its speed, security, & scalability?
Intermediate

Sui: How are users leveraging its speed, security, & scalability?

Sui is a PoS L1 blockchain with a novel architecture whose object-centric model enables parallelization of transactions through verifier level scaling. In this research paper the unique features of the Sui blockchain will be introduced, the economic prospects of SUI tokens will be presented, and it will be explained how investors can learn about which dApps are driving the use of the chain through the Sui application campaign.
8-13-2025, 7:33:39 AM
Dive into Hyperliquid
Intermediate

Dive into Hyperliquid

Hyperliquid's vision is to develop an on-chain open financial system. At the core of this ecosystem is Hyperliquid L1, where every interaction, whether an order, cancellation, or settlement, is executed on-chain. Hyperliquid excels in product and marketing and has no external investors. With the launch of its second season points program, more and more people are becoming enthusiastic about on-chain trading. Hyperliquid has expanded from a trading product to building its own ecosystem.
6-19-2024, 6:39:42 AM